Smartband or Smartwatch?

If you don’t know whether to choose between a smart band or smartwatch, and you don’t know the advantages of one type of fitness tracker on the other, I’ll briefly explain what the differences are.

A fitness smartwatch is an equivalent of a watch with Smart functionality, i.e., connected to the Internet or to another device from which it draws the ability to access advanced information.

Usually, despite the size, smartwatches have autonomy of a few days (sometimes they barely arrive in the evening) and are more reliable in the analysis of sports activities.

I do not recommend them, however, for sleep monitoring. In the evening, they must often be loaded, and you could often lose very important data if you are looking for a generic wrist device.

That is, also, for the management of notifications (and possible response), for the reproduction of photos or navigation via GPS, the smartwatch is certainly better. All this, however, weighs heavily on battery life.

The smart fitness band, however, is the equivalent of Smart bracelets. They also connect to an external smartphone for online connectivity, but – thanks to the presence of displays of smaller size and quality – they often offer a much longer battery life.

On these devices, you cannot reproduce photos or images, even if the latest models have color panels, but offer autonomy that can exceed two weeks.

Thanks to this feature, they are excellent fitness trackers both during the day and during the night: if you are interested in keeping track of your night habits, I recommend this particular type of fitness tracker.

Furthermore, smart bands can also reproduce the notifications of the paired smartphone, even if they offer much less possibility of interaction and management of the same.

Display

A display is almost always present inside a smartwatch, but the same is not always true on smart bands. In most modern models, however, it is very difficult not to find an integrated panel for viewing the time, date, or even the notifications arriving on the paired smartphone.

On smart bands, the displays are usually very small, monochromatic or in color, while on smartwatches they are usually with a diagonal greater than the thumb (sometimes the size of the display of a smartwatch or a smart band is also indicated in millimeters), and with dials of different shapes:

The panel resolution indicates the number of pixels present in it, and, for the same diagonal, it is possible to establish its definition (i.e., how many pixels are present in a specific area).

For example, if the resolution is 320 × 320 pixels, a fairly high definition of 320 pixels on the horizontal side and another 320 pixels on the vertical side is indicated.

If the panel is circular, however, it is clear that both numbers represent the diameter of the display. The most modern smartwatches and smart bands can almost always be controlled by touch, thanks to the implementation of touch-screen panels.

Fitness trackers often use OLED displays, since they are more energy-efficient than LCDs (liquid crystal), and also brighter, despite having the ability to turn off the black pixels to offer a better contrast ratio and a made perfect in the dark.

One technology used in the past on some fitness tracker models was e-Paper technology, which allowed optimal visibility under sunlight (even better than OLEDs), consuming energy only in the change of state (for example, between one page to another ).

Have you ever heard of always-on displays instead? This feature indicates the possibility of keeping the display always on, even when the smartphone is not used.

Usually, when this function is not present, the display turns off to save energy, turning on only with a tap with the gesture of the arm that is performed to watch the time.

If present, however, the panel remains on in an energy-saving mode when not in use, while it activates in all its functions when the gesture I have just described is performed.

Strap

The straps of a fitness tracker can, fortunately, be replaced in the vast majority of cases, both if you buy a smartwatch, and if you choose a smart band.

In the latter case, you are almost always forced to choose dedicated straps for the specific bracelet model. At the same time, smartwatches often use standards compatible between multiple models, indicated with the width of the strap.

In the presence of a proprietary attachment system, such as on Apple Watch, it is still necessary to choose specific straps for that model.

Often some fitness tracker models are sold with non-universal straps, indicated with the letters of the alphabet S, M, or L, which, respectively, define the sizes Small, Medium, or Large. In this case, try to find the most suitable size for your wrist size.

Autonomy

As you have already understood, autonomy is one of the fundamental parameters of your fitness tracker, given that it relentlessly establishes the functions that you can use.

Usually, manufacturers indicate (almost always very optimistically) the battery life in days in the list of characteristics of each model. In contrast, the technical specifications of the battery are indicated in milliampere hours ( mAh ).

The plate data of a smartwatch or a smart band are not always effective; however, since in the use of a fitness tracker, many variables contribute to establishing its autonomy day after day.

For example, the width of a display, the always-on functionality or the use of the GPS module sacrifice autonomy a lot: in GPS mode any fitness tracker can, in fact, last only for a few hours, except specific models for sports activities that they have a very long lifespan.

Water Resistance

If you practice outdoor sports or even pool activities, it is very important to select water-resistant models. The models that enjoy IP certification can also be used in the shower.

Although manufacturers often advise against using them at sea or in saltwater. These models often have an analysis of swimming activities, and can also be used in very humid environments without incurring breakage risks.

Another wording that you can find on models that can be used underwater is 3ATM or 5ATM: the first suggests the possibility of using the fitness tracker at a depth of 30 meters, the second up to 50 meters, obviously in both cases within certain time limits.

Operating Systems

Many watches, especially those more related to the sports world, use a proprietary operating system, as well as almost all smart bands in circulation.

In this case, you should read the functions it has and, above all, the smartphones that are compatible with pairing (between iPhone and models with Android) and which functions they can take advantage of once combined.

For example, some models can read the notifications of some smartphones but can only allow the response on some specific models.

  • Apple Watch Os – needs no big presentations. It is the Apple Watch operating system and is tailor-made for iPhones (in theory, it can also be associated with Android, but in a very limited way). It is recognized that it offers the best user experience on smartwatches, but to fully exploit it, you need to have an Apple smartphone.
  • Google Wear Os – is Google’s operating system for smartwatches, which instead gives its best if paired with an Android smartphone. It works, however, also with the iPhone, although some functions are not supported in the latter case.
  • Samsung Tizen Os – Samsung’s system is somewhere in between Apple’s and Google’s approaches. Although it can be used in conjunction with any Android device, and also with iPhone, it gives its best if it is paired with a Galaxy series smartphone.
  • Fitbit Os – one of the most important players in the fitness tracker sector is Fitbit, now acquired by Google. The models of the American company make use of a proprietary operating system capable of synchronizing both with the iPhone, albeit with some restrictions in the management of notifications, and with Android devices.

Fitness Functions

Now let’s move on to the fitness functions of a fitness tracker, which are the most important, although it is very convenient to read the notifications on a smartwatch or a smart bracelet.

It is clear that a device of this type must be mainly reliable in reading the data collected daily, and must give useful advice for the improvement of one’s health and well-being personnel.

And this is possible thanks to a series of sensors, such as accelerometers, heart rate monitors, or gyroscopes, for example, integrated inside them.

Pedometer and Activity Analysis

The step count, also called the pedometer function, works thanks to the use of a digital accelerometer present in the fitness tracker.

It allows you to keep track of the steps taken every day, and dedicated software on your smartphone saves all the history, creating daily, weekly, and monthly statistics to offer a map of the progress made.

In a fitness tracker, the analysis of the activities carried out is fundamental. Thanks to the data collected, the compatible app on the smartphone can perform an analysis of the activities carried out.

Create a statistic that is always updated over time with a complete history of all the objectives achieved, day after day. Also, the apps of the most advanced models implement a sort of personal trainer capable of advising based on the same data to improve health conditions and sports performance in your favorite activities.

Some models (now practically all of them) also show data such as distance traveled, counting plans, and, by combining all the data – even those of the sports activities carried out – it is also possible to monitor the estimate of the calories burned.

Heart

The heart rate monitor is a sensor that manages to analyze the wearer’s heart rate, often throughout the day. Monitoring this data can be useful during sports activities, to keep the heart rate constant, but also during the day to find out about any cardiac problems.

The analysis carried out by a fitness tracker is not 100% reliable, therefore before being alarmed, it is always good to consult a reference doctor.

Some high-end models also implement the electrocardiogram, that is, a function that uses the integrated sensors to evaluate the frequency and intensity of the electrical impulses produced by the heartbeat.

If potentially dangerous cardiac arrhythmias occur, the fitness tracker can notify the user, and even in this case, it is advisable to consult a trained doctor.

Gps Support

As I wrote above, the GPS module is one of the most expensive functions in terms of energy consumption, but it is also among the most useful if you do outdoor sports such as running, cycling, and more.

It allows you to trace the path taken during outdoor training, and, in the most advanced smartwatch models, it can be used in satellite navigation mode to know how to get to a destination.

Other Fitness Features

The best fitness trackers can have many features related to fitness and many “lifestyle” features. In models designed for athletes, there is the possibility of connecting a heart rate monitor, which allows an analysis of the heartbeat often more reliable and precise.

While other models support automatic recognition of sports activity, a function that allows you to enable a certain type of “tracking” once you start a specific exercise (such as running, cycling, swimming, hiking, or other).

I have already told you about sleep monitoring, which allows you to analyze daily habits and verify the data on light, deep, and REM sleep when you wake up.

This function also offers advice on the time to go to bed, to improve the quality of night’s sleep and the general well-being of the user.

Among the useful functions, mainly for the sportsman but not only, but there are also the stopwatch or the timer (careful, because, although they are very simple functions to implement, they are not always present), or even the possibility to change the dial and information always visible to screen.
